First of all, having a top-pair guy like <a href=\"https:\/\/www.hockey-reference.com\/players\/c\/chychja01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=lastwordonsports.com&amp;utm_campaign=2023-10-10_hr\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Jakob Chychrun<\/a> for a full season will pay dividends. He is a defenceman with career-highs of 41 points, 23:23 TOI, and a PS = 7.4, a fantastic add with the pieces already in place. Additionally, the sophomore <a href=\"https:\/\/www.hockey-reference.com\/players\/s\/sandeja01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=lastwordonsports.com&amp;utm_campaign=2023-10-10_hr\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Jake Sanderson<\/a> has a year under his belt. Last year he scored 32 points in 21:55 TOI and played both specialty teams. We see no reason why he won\u2019t improve on a stellar rookie campaign. <a href=\"https:\/\/www.hockey-reference.com\/players\/c\/chaboth01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=lastwordonsports.com&amp;utm_campaign=2023-10-10_hr\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Thomas Chabot<\/a> will feel less of a load with the supporting cast and allow him to excel. The Senators are <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/hockey\/2023\/08\/04\/a-strategic-plan-for-joonas-korpisalo-and-the-ottawa-senators-goaltenders\/\" target=\"_self\">well equipped in between the pipes<\/a>, with <a href=\"https:\/\/www.hockey-reference.com\/players\/k\/korpijo01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=lastwordonsports.com&amp;utm_campaign=2023-10-10_hr\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Joonas Korpisalo<\/a>,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.hockey-reference.com\/players\/f\/forsban01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=lastwordonsports.com&amp;utm_campaign=2023-10-10_hr\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Anton Forsberg<\/a>, and two prospects,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.hockey-reference.com\/players\/s\/sogaama01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=lastwordonsports.com&amp;utm_campaign=2023-10-10_hr\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Mads Sogaard<\/a> and <a href=\"https:\/\/www.hockey-reference.com\/players\/m\/merille01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=lastwordonsports.com&amp;utm_campaign=2023-10-10_hr\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Leevi Merilainen<\/a>. It is exciting to imagine the possibilities of whether Korpisalo and Forsberg can relive the magic that won them the 2016 Calder Cup championship. Korpisalo is coming off a season with a .914 SV% in 39 games played, and a career-best GSAA of 11.5. Meanwhile, Forsberg is coming off knee injuries <a href=\"https:\/\/ottawasun.com\/sports\/hockey\/nhl\/ottawa-senators\/senators-have-stabilized-net-with-korpisalo-forsberg\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">but is looking ready<\/a>. In his three years with Ottawa, he has posted a .911 SV% along with three shutouts. The Sens have confidence in the tandem to split games between them to get the club through the regular season. If either falter, both Sogaard and Merilainen will be breathing hard down their necks. They are highly-touted goaltender prospects and would love a chance to prove themselves.<\/p>\n<h3>The Top Brass<\/h3>\n<p>One final point where the Ottawa Senators as an organization have seen development and maturity is the front office. First and foremost, is the new owner, Michael Andlauer. Besides deep pockets, and, as shown, a willingness to spend to the cap, he has a plethora of experience. He owns the Brantford Bulldogs of the OHL, and relinquished his previously owned minority ownership stakes in the <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/hockey\/category\/canadiens\/\" target=\"_self\">Montreal Canadiens<\/a> to purchase the Sens. Next, he decided to hire Sean Tierney to head up the analytics department for the club. Finally, he <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/hockey\/2023\/09\/29\/ottawa-senators-appoint-president-of-hockey-operations\/\" target=\"_self\">added a President of Hockey Operations<\/a>, with professional acumen, and previous working relationship factor in <a href=\"https:\/\/www.hockey-reference.com\/players\/s\/staiost01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=lastwordonsports.com&amp;utm_campaign=2023-10-10_hr\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Steve Staios<\/a>. Andlauer even gave Dorion the initial stamp of approval.
